TL;DR: This study confirms that foreign travel, especially to the Indian subcontinent and Africa, represents a major risk for rectal colonization with CTX-M-producing E coli and contributed to the Worldwide spread of these bacteria.
Abstract: Background We previously identified foreign travel as a risk factor for acquiring infections due to CTX‐M (active on cefotaxime first isolated in Munich) producing Escherichia coli The objective of this study was to assess the prevalence of extended‐spectrum β‐lactamase (ESBL)‐producing E coli among stool samples submitted from travelers as compared to non‐travelers (a non‐traveler had not been outside of Canada for at least 6 months before submitting a stool specimen) Methods Once a travel case was identified, the next stool from a non‐traveler (not been outside of Canada for at least 6 months) was included and cultured on the chromID‐ESBL selection media Molecular characterization was done using polymerase chain reaction and sequencing for bla CTX‐Ms, bla TEMs, bla SHVs, plasmid‐mediated quinolone‐resistant determinants, O25‐ST131, phylogenetic groups, pulsed‐field gel electrophoresis (PFGE), and multilocus sequencing typing Results A total of 226 individuals were included; 195 (86%) were negative, and 31 (14%) were positive for ESBL‐producing E coli Notably, travelers were 52 (95% CI 21–311) times more likely than non‐travelers to have an ESBL‐producing E coli cultured from their stool The highest rates of ESBL positivity were associated with travel to Africa or the Indian subcontinent Among the 31 ESBL‐producing E coli isolated, 22 produced CTX‐M‐15, 8 produced CTX‐M‐14, 1 produced CTX‐M‐8, 12 were positive for aac(6 ′ )‐Ib‐cr , and 8 belonged to clone ST131 Conclusions Our study confirms that foreign travel, especially to the Indian subcontinent and Africa, represents a major risk for rectal colonization with CTX‐M‐producing E coli and contributed to the Worldwide spread of these bacteria

TL;DR: These kinds of mycoses are increasingly frequent in non-endemic areas, and newer and faster techniques should be used to reach an early diagnosis.
Abstract: Background. Histoplasmosis and paracoccidioidomycosis (PCM) have increased in Spain in recent years, due firstly to the migration from endemic regions and secondly to travelers returning from these regions. In non-endemic areas, diagnosis of both diseases is hampered by the lack of experience, long silent periods, and the resemblance to other diseases such as tuberculosis and sarcoidosis. Methods. A total of 39 cases of imported histoplasmosis and 6 cases of PCM diagnosed in the Spanish Mycology Reference Laboratory since 2006 were analyzed. Microbiological diagnosis was performed using classical methods and also a specific real-time polymerase chain reaction (RT-PCR) assay for each microorganism. Results. We had 9 cases of probable histoplasmosis in travelers and 30 cases in immigrants, 29 of whom were defined as proven. Paracoccidioidomycosis (PCM) cases were either immigrants or people who had lived for a long period of time in endemic regions, all of whom were classified as proven cases. Cultures showed a good sensitivity in detecting Histoplasma capsulatum in immigrants with proven histoplasmosis (73%); however, growth was very slow. The fungus was never recovered in traveler patients. Paracoccidioides brasiliensis was isolated in a culture only in one case of the proven PCM. Serological methods were not very reliable in immunocompromized patients with histoplasmosis (40%). A PCR-based technique for histoplasmosis detected 55.5% of the cases in travelers (probable cases) and 89% of the cases in immigrants (proven). The PCR method for PCM detected 100% of the cases. Conclusions. These kinds of mycoses are increasingly frequent in non-endemic areas, and newer and faster techniques should be used to reach an early diagnosis. The RT-PCR techniques developed appear to be sensitive, specific, and fast and could be helpful to detect those mycoses. However, it is also essential that physicians perform differential diagnosis in individuals coming from endemic areas.

TL;DR: The most common pathogens causing TD in Nepal were Campylobacter, ETEC, and Shigella, and one of these drugs could be used as empiric therapy for TD with the other reserved for treatment failures.
Abstract: Background Diarrhea is the most common illness among travelers and expatriates in Nepal. Published data on the etiology of travelers' diarrhea (TD) in Nepal are over 13 years old and no prior data exist on antibiotic susceptibility for currently used drugs. We investigated the etiology of diarrhea and antimicrobial susceptibility pattern of bacterial pathogens and compared the results to previous work from the same clinical setting. Methods A total of 381 cases and 176 controls were enrolled between March 2001 and 2003 in a case‐control study. Enrollees were over age 18 years from high socioeconomic countries visiting or living in Nepal. Stool samples were assessed by microbiologic, molecular identification, and enzyme immunoassay (EIA) methods, and antimicrobial susceptibility was determined by disk diffusion. Risk factors were assessed by questionnaires. Results At least one enteropathogen was identified in 263 of 381 (69%) cases and 47 of 176 (27%) controls ( p ≤ 0.001). Pathogens significantly detected among cases were Campylobacter (17%), enterotoxigenic Escherichia coli (ETEC) (15%), Shigella (13%), and Giardia (11%). Cyclospora was detected only in cases (8%) mainly during monsoon season. Although 71% of Campylobacter isolates were resistant to ciprofloxacin, 80% of bacterial isolates overall were sensitive to either ciprofloxacin or azithromycin while 20% were intermediately sensitive or resistant. No bacterial isolates were resistant to both drugs. Conclusions The most common pathogens causing TD in Nepal were Campylobacter , ETEC, and Shigella . Because resistance to fluoroquinolone or azithromycin was similar, one of these drugs could be used as empiric therapy for TD with the other reserved for treatment failures.

TL;DR: Rabies is an irreversible, fatal disease most frequently characterized by acute encephalitis that causes approximately 55,000 deaths annually in Africa and Asia and those who travel to areas with high epizootic endemicity are at increased risk of exposure and death.
Abstract: Rabies is an irreversible, fatal disease most frequently characterized by acute encephalitis that causes approximately 55,000 deaths annually in Africa and Asia. Disease occurs when rabies virus, a Lyssavirus , is transmitted to a human via the saliva of an infected mammalian carnivore or bat, usually a dog, if it comes in contact with mucous membranes or enters the body via a bite, scratch, or lick on broken skin. Animal reservoirs for rabies exist in all continental areas worldwide. Deaths are presumed to be underreported in areas with poor access to medical facilities. Children are considered to be at a higher risk than adults.1,2 Although the risk of contracting rabies in developed countries is generally low, those who travel to areas with high epizootic endemicity are at increased risk of exposure and death. Steffen and co‐workers evaluated the risk of rabies infection due to animal bites in travelers to developing countries and found an incidence rate per month between 0.1% and 1%.3 An epidemiological study of travelers presenting to GeoSentinel sites worldwide performed by the US Centers for Disease Control and Prevention (CDC) and the International Society of Travel Medicine (ISTM) found that 4.7% of this population required rabies post‐exposure prophylaxis.4 After acquisition of the virus, the incubation period is variable, usually between 20 and 90 d, although occasionally disease develops after only a few days, and, in rare cases, more than a year following exposure. Usually patients develop a furious form of the disease, with episodes of generalized hyperexcitability separated by lucid periods. Encephalitis results from viral replication in the brain. In 20% of cases, a paralytic form of the disease results in progressive immobility. Both forms of rabies, furious and paralytic, are always fatal. TL;DR: The modified ID schedule used in this case series was highly effective, had similar immunogenicity to the standard ID schedule, and should be considered in travelers who are unable to complete standard IM or standard ID courses of rabies vaccines.
Abstract: Background. Current Australian recommendations for rabies pre-exposure vaccination involve the use of cell-culture-based rabies vaccines, which are administered via intramuscular (IM) or intradermal (ID) routes. ID vaccination is more affordable for travelers, but is only recommended if there is sufficient time to perform serology 2 to 3 weeks post-vaccination and confirm immunity prior to travel. We report the immunogenicity of a modified ID schedule that can be completed in less time than the standard ID schedule, and allow more travelers to be vaccinated prior to departure. Methods. Travelers were offered a modified schedule if they were unable to afford standard IM vaccinations, and did not have time to complete a standard ID course. The modified schedule consisted of two ID injections of 0.1 mL of human diploid cell rabies vaccine administered on days 0 and 7, and serology was performed to determine immune status at a time between day 21 and 28. Results. A total of 420 travelers aged between 10 and 65 years were vaccinated using the modified ID course. The overall seroconversion rate was 94.5%, with 397 travelers developing antibody levels of >0.5 IU/mL when tested at approximately 21 days post-vaccination. Conclusion. The modified ID schedule used in this case series was highly effective, had similar immunogenicity to the standard ID schedule, and should be considered in travelers who are unable to complete standard IM or standard ID courses of rabies vaccines.

TL;DR: It is suggested that the frequency and severity of jellyfish stings affecting tourists in Southeast Asia have been significantly underestimated and the application of marine stinger prevention and treatment principles throughout the region may help reduce the incidence and severity.
Abstract: Background: Jellyfish are a common cause of injury throughout the world, with fatalities and severe systemic events not uncommon after tropical stings. The internet is a recent innovation to gain information on real-time health issues of travel destinations, including Southeast Asia. Methods: We applied the model of internet-based retrospective health data aggregation, through the Divers Alert Network Asia-Pacific (DAN AP), together with more conventional methods of literature and media searches, to document the health significance, and clinical spectrum, of box jellyfish stings in Malaysia for the period January 1, 2000 to July 30, 2010. Results: Three fatalities, consistent with chirodropid envenomation, were identified for the period—all tourists to Malaysia. Non-fatal chirodropid stings were also documented. During 2010, seven cases consistent with moderately severe Irukandji syndrome were reported to DAN and two representative cases are discussed here. Photographs of chirodropid (multi-tentacled), carybdeid (four-tentacled) box jellyfish, and of severe sting lesions were also submitted to DAN during this period. Conclusions: This study suggests that the frequency and severity of jellyfish stings affecting tourists in Southeast Asia have been significantly underestimated. Severe and fatal cases of chirodropid-type stings occur in coastal waters off Peninsular Malaysia and Sabah, Borneo. Indeed, the first Malaysian cases consistent with Irukandji-like syndrome are reported here. Reports to DAN, a provider of emergency advice to divers, offer one method to address the historic lack of formalized reporting mechanisms for such events, for photo-documentation of the possible culprit species and treatment advice. The application of marine stinger prevention and treatment principles throughout the region may help reduce the incidence and severity of such stings. Meanwhile travelers and their medical advisors should be aware of the hazards of these stings throughout the Asia-Pacific.

TL;DR: A descriptive, cross-sectional design study of cases of malaria, hepatitis A, and typhoid reported to the Quebec registry of notifiable diseases between January 2004 and December 2007 shows that VFR children should be a primary target group for pre-travel preventive measures.
Abstract: Background. Visiting friends and relatives (VFRs), especially young VFRs, are increasingly recognized in the industrialized world as a high-risk group of travelers. Methods. We performed a descriptive, cross-sectional design study of cases of malaria, hepatitis A, and typhoid reported to the Quebec registry of notifiable diseases between January 2004 and December 2007, occurring in VFRs and non-VFRs travelers. Results. VFRs account for 52.9% of malaria cases, 56.9% of hepatitis A cases, and 94.4% of typhoid cases reported in Quebec travelers. Almost all (91.6%) of the malaria cases among VFRs were acquired in Africa, particularly in sub-Saharan Africa. An important proportion of malaria cases among VFRs (86.4%) were due to Plasmodium falciparum. The vast majority (76.6%) of typhoid fever cases among VFRs were reported by travelers who had visited the Indian subcontinent. Among VFRs, 40% of total cases were under 20 y of age, compared to less than 6% among non-VFRs. Those under 20 years of age also accounted for 16.9% of malaria cases, 50% of typhoid cases, and 65.2% of hepatitis A cases among VFRs. Conclusion. Our study clearly shows that VFR children should be a primary target group for pre-travel preventive measures.

TL;DR: Routine prescription of stand-by antibiotics for these immunocompromised short-term travelers to areas with good health facilities is probably not more useful than for healthy travelers.
Abstract: Background. Immunocompromised travelers to developing countries are thought to have symptomatic infectious diseases more often and longer than non-immunocompromised travelers. Evidence for this is lacking. This study evaluates whether immunocompromised short-term travelers are at increased risk of diseases. Methods. A prospective study was performed between October 2003 and May 2010 among adult travelers using immunosuppressive agents (ISA) and travelers with inflammatory bowel disease (IBD), with their non-immunocompromised travel companions serving as matched controls with comparable exposure to infection. Data on symptoms of infectious diseases were recorded by using a structured diary. Results. Among 75 ISA, the incidence of travel-related diarrhea was 0.76 per person-month, and the number of symptomatic days 1.32 per month. For their 75 controls, figures were 0.66 and 1.50, respectively (p > 0.05). Among 71 IBD, the incidence was 1.19, and the number of symptomatic days was 2.48. For their 71 controls, figures were 0.73 and 1.31, respectively (p > 0.05). These differences also existed before travel. ISA had significantly more and longer travel-related signs of skin infection and IBD suffered more and longer from vomiting. As for other symptoms, no significant travel-related differences were found. Only 21% of immunocompromised travelers suffering from diarrhea used their stand-by antibiotics. Conclusions. ISA and IBD did not have symptomatic infectious diseases more often or longer than non-immunocompromised travelers, except for signs of travel-related skin infection among ISA. Routine prescription of stand-by antibiotics for these immunocompromised travelers to areas with good health facilities is probably not more useful than for healthy travelers.

TL;DR: The majority of travelers seeking PEP at this clinic initiated treatment overseas, and most had not received RIG abroad, when it would have been appropriate, which is a concern to those without preexposure rabies immunization.
Abstract: Background In 2009, 58.6 million UK residents traveled abroad. Of these, 49.5 million (84.5%) visits were to Europe and North America and 9.1 million (15.5%) were to other parts of the world. Rabies is widely distributed and continues to be a major public health issue in many developing countries. The UK is free of rabies in carnivore host species, although cases of rabies in bats have been reported. This study examined the rabies postexposure prophylaxis (PEP) service from 2000 to July 2009 at the Liverpool School of Tropical Medicine. Methods Medical records of patients who attended the clinic for rabies PEP were reviewed. Results During the study period, 139 patients were treated for possible rabies exposure. The mean age was 35 years. Thailand and Turkey each accounted for 31 (22.3%) cases. Sixty‐nine (49.6%) of those seen were due to dog bites. Most injuries involved a lower limb ( n = 67, 48.2%) or hands ( n = 26, 18.7%). Eighty‐six (61.9%) cases had initiated rabies PEP overseas, but only 3 of the 78 (3.8%) meeting UK criteria for rabies immunoglobulin (RIG) received it while overseas. Only an additional 11 patients received RIG on return to the UK; most were seen more than 7 days after initiation of PEP. The median time from exposure to receiving rabies PEP was 1 day (range: 0–1,720). Only 14 (10.1%) had received preexposure rabies vaccination. Conclusions The majority of travelers seeking PEP at this clinic initiated treatment overseas. Most had not received RIG abroad, when it would have been appropriate. Initiation of appropriate treatment is often delayed and is a concern to those without preexposure rabies immunization. In view of the scarcity of RIG, travelers need to be aware of the risks, consider preexposure immunization, and present early for PEP.

TL;DR: Serum schistosome DNA detection in serum was able to confirm infection in all exposed persons, and clearly outperformed antibody tests and microscopic parasite detection methods as a qualitative diagnostic test.
Abstract: Background. Diagnosis of acute schistosomiasis is often elusive in travelers. Serum schistosome DNA detection is a promising new diagnostic tool. Its performance is compared with current diagnostic procedures in a cluster of travelers recently infected in Rwanda. Methods. Recent infection with schistosomiasis was suspected in 13 Belgian children and adults, within 2 months after swimming in the Muhazi Lake, Rwanda. All were subjected to clinical examination, eosinophil count, feces parasite detection, schistosome antibody tests [enzyme-linked immunosorbent assay (ELISA) and hemagglutination inhibition assay (HAI)], and schistosome DNA detection in serum by real-time polymerase chain reaction. Results. All 13 patients, between 6 and 29 years old, had a high eosinophil count (median 2,120 µL−1; range 1,150–14,270). Seven of nine persons exposed for the first time developed symptoms compatible with acute schistosomiasis. Eggs of Schistosoma mansoni were found in a concentrated feces sample of 9/13 (69%), with low egg counts (median 20 eggs per gram; range 10–120). Antischistosome antibodies (ELISA and/or HAI) were present in serum of 10/13 (77%) patients. Combining schistosome antibody tests and fecal microscopy demonstrated schistosomiasis in 11/13 (85%) patients. Schistosome-specific DNA was isolated in all 13 (100%) serum samples. Conclusion. In this cluster of travelers with acute schistosomiasis, schistosome DNA detection in serum was able to confirm infection in all exposed persons. It clearly outperformed antibody tests and microscopic parasite detection methods as a qualitative diagnostic test.

TL;DR: About one third of the foreign backpackers in Southeast Asia had experienced diarrhea during their trip, and their current practices related to the risk of travelers' diarrhea were inadequate and should be improved.
Abstract: Background. Travelers' diarrhea is the most common disease reported among travelers visiting developing countries, including Southeast Asia, a region visited by large numbers of backpackers each year. Currently, the knowledge of travelers' diarrhea among this group is limited. This study aimed to determine the incidence and impact of travelers' diarrhea in this group. Method. Foreign backpackers in Khao San road, Bangkok, Thailand, were invited to fill out a study questionnaire, in which they were queried about their demographic background, travel characteristics, pretravel preparations and actual practices related to the risk of travelers' diarrhea. For backpackers who had experienced diarrhea, the details and impact of each diarrheal episode were also assessed. Results. In the period April to May 2009, 404 completed questionnaires were collected and analyzed. Sixty percent of participants were male; overall, the median age was 26 years. Nearly all backpackers (96.8%) came from developed countries. Their main reason for travel was tourism (88%). The median stay was 30 days. More than half of the backpackers (56%) carried some antidiarrheal medication. Antimotility drugs were the most common medications carried by backpackers, followed by oral rehydration salts (ORS), and antibiotics. Their practices were far from ideal; 93.9% had bought food from street vendors, 92.5% had drunk beverages with ice-cubes, and 33.8% had eaten leftover food from a previous meal. In this study, 30.7% (124/404) of backpackers had experienced diarrhea during their trip. Most diarrhea cases (88%) were mild and recovered spontaneously. However, 8.8% of cases required a visit to a doctor, and 3.2% needed hospitalization. Longer duration of stay and drinking beverages with ice-cubes were associated with higher risk of diarrhea. Conclusions. About one third of the foreign backpackers in Southeast Asia had experienced diarrhea during their trip. Their current practices related to the risk of travelers' diarrhea were inadequate and should be improved.

TL;DR: Violence and unintentional injury are substantial risks for patrons of international resorts offering a hedonistic nightlife and understanding those characteristics of resorts and their visitors most closely associated with such risks should help inform prevention initiatives that protect both the health of tourists and the economy of resorts marketed as safe and enjoyable places to visit.
Abstract: Background. Young people's alcohol and drug use increases during holidays. Despite strong associations between substance use and both violence and unintentional injury, little is known about this relationship in young people holidaying abroad. We examine how risks of violence and unintentional injury abroad relate to substance use and the effects of nationality and holiday destination on these relationships. Methods. A cross-sectional comparative survey of 6,502 British and German holidaymakers aged 16 to 35 years was undertaken in airports in Cyprus, Greece, Italy, Portugal, and Spain. Results. Overall, 3.8% of participants reported having been in a physical fight (violence) on holiday and 5.9% reported unintentional injury. Two thirds reported having been drunk on holiday and over 10% using illicit drugs. Levels of drunkenness, drug use, violence, and unintentional injury all varied with nationality and holiday destination. Violence was independently associated with being male, choosing the destination for its nightlife, staying 8 to 14 days, smoking and using drugs on holiday, frequent drunkenness, and visiting Majorca (both nationalities) or Crete (British only). Predictors of unintentional injury were being male, younger, using drugs other than just cannabis on holiday, frequent drunkenness, and visiting Crete (both nationalities). Conclusions. Violence and unintentional injury are substantial risks for patrons of international resorts offering a hedonistic nightlife. Understanding those characteristics of resorts and their visitors most closely associated with such risks should help inform prevention initiatives that protect both the health of tourists and the economy of resorts marketed as safe and enjoyable places to visit. TL;DR: NCC in travelers is a rare phenomenon commonly presenting as seizure disorder manifesting months to years post-travel, and antihelminthic therapy followed by 12 to 24 months of antiepileptic therapy resulted in complete resolution of symptoms in patients.
Abstract: Background. Cysticercosis, a human infestation by Taenia solium is endemic in many resource-limited countries. In developed countries it is mostly encountered among immigrant populations. Only few cases are reported in travelers. This report summarizes a nation-wide study of neurocysticercosis (NCC) diagnosed among Israeli travelers to endemic countries, with an estimation of disease incidence among the traveler population. Methods. We performed a retrospective, nation-wide survey of travel-related NCC in Israel between the years 1994 and 2009. Results. Nine cases of NCC were diagnosed in Israeli travelers during the study years. Most patients had traveled to South and/or Southeast Asia. The most common symptom at diagnosis was a seizure. The average interval between return from the suspected travel and symptom onset was 3.2 ± 1.8 years. Two patients suffered from multiple lesions, whereas the rest had a single lesion. Antihelminthic treatment was given to most patients with resolution of symptoms. Median duration of antiepileptic treatment was 16 ± 41 months after albendazole was given. Antiepileptic treatment was discontinued without any complications. The estimated attack rate of clinical disease was 1 : 275,000 per travel episode to an endemic region. Conclusions. NCC in travelers is a rare phenomenon commonly presenting as seizure disorder manifesting months to years post-travel. Antihelminthic therapy followed by 12 to 24 months of antiepileptic therapy resulted in complete resolution of symptoms in our patients.

TL;DR: Antibiotic prophylaxis of TD in Mexico during the dry season needs to be further studied and its benefits weighed against the benefits of self-treatment.
Abstract: Background. Rifaximin has been shown to be effective in treating and preventing travelers' diarrhea (TD) during the summer season. Methods. The goal of this double-blinded multicenter trial was to assess the efficacy and safety of rifaximin 550 mg administered once daily for 14 days compared with placebo in the prevention of TD during the dry season in Mexico. Results. There were 101 participants randomized. Overall, 25 participants developed TD during the 3 weeks of the study: 22% from the rifaximin group and 29% from the placebo group (p = 0.4). Mild diarrhea (defined as only one or two unformed stools during a 24-h period plus at least one abdominal symptoms) developed in only 3 (6%) participants taking rifaximin compared with 10 (21%) taking placebo during the first week of study (p = 0.03). No clinically significant or serious adverse events were reported. Conclusions. Antibiotic prophylaxis of TD in Mexico during the dry season needs to be further studied and its benefits weighed against the benefits of self-treatment.

TL;DR: This case highlights the importance of obtaining even remote travel histories from ill immigrants and considering occult quartan malaria in patients from endemic locations with nephrotic syndrome.
Abstract: A 34-year-old Nigerian man presented with nephrotic syndrome. Renal biopsy revealed chronic membranous glomerulopathy with focal segmental sclerosis. Blood Giemsa smear contained rare Plasmodium sp. trophozoites and small subunit ribosomal RNA polymerase chain reaction amplification confirmed the presence of Plasmodium malariae. This case highlights the importance of obtaining even remote travel histories from ill immigrants and considering occult quartan malaria in patients from endemic locations with nephrotic syndrome.
